As part of Other Arts first full season of new music events, pianist 
(and list-member) Louis Goldstein will be performing Morton Feldman's 
Triadic Memories and John Cage's Sonatas and Interludes for prepared 
piano in the Van Cliburn Recital Hall of the Maddox-Muse Center, 330 
East 4th Street in downtown Fort Worth, just east of Bass Performance Hall.

Goldstein will perform Triadic Memories on Sunday December 2, 2007 
beginning at 7:30 PM; he will perform Sonatas & Interludes on Monday 
December 3, 2007. This is a rare chance to hear excellent performances 
of two of the major piano works of the 20th century over a two-day span.
